Artificial Intelligence: What is it and How Does it Work?

Artificial intelligence is a field of the development of computer systems capable of performing tasks that typically require human ability. These systems process large datasets to detect patterns and make inferences. AI algorithms can be categorized into several types, including supervised learning, unsupervised learning, and reinforcement learning. Supervised learning employs labeled data to teach models, while unsupervised learning uncovers patterns in unlabeled data. Reinforcement learning rewards desired behaviors through a system of feedback.

The development and deployment of AI tools raise ethical issues regarding bias, privacy, and job displacement. It is crucial to develop and implement AI carefully to ensure that it benefits society as a whole.

Charting the Landscape of AI: From Narrow to General Intelligence

The sphere of artificial intelligence (AI) is steadily evolving, with breakthroughs occurring at an remarkable pace. Traditionally, AI has been classified as narrow or weak AI, programmed to accomplish defined tasks with impressive proficiency. However, the aspiration of achieving general artificial intelligence (AGI) – an AI construct capable of comprehending and reacting to a diverse range of mental tasks – remains a significant endeavor.
